My bathtub drain gets blocked very easily. I guess it's mainly due to hair and sludge cos my daughter uses the shower over the bath everyday. I tried un-blockers (a chemical bottle) and it improved for a few days and then became slow draining again.

My neighbour suggested the blockage could be further down the line in the drain, but I doubt it since the toilet and sink in the same bathroom work fine, assuming they all share the same drain pipe?

Any tips for me to keep it clear without calling in Dyno-rod? many thanks.

Buy yourself a wet vac. The Wickes one is only about £50. You will need to seal the overflow (I use a big lump of Blu-Tac) then suck the hair and gunk out through the plughole. I also use blu-tac around the end of the hose to get a good seal. You'll have to pick and pull some of it through but it works a treat.
